Right now there's only 3 fighters that could stake a claim to being the best of this generation. Usyk, Loma and Canelo and right now I don't think there's really a clear obvious choice. Some might say Canelo because he's the big PPV star and won titles in 4 divisions but he's had some very close fights. Loma's won titles in 3 weight divisions but the loss to Lopez takes some of the shine off that. Maybe if he beats Lopez in a rematch and then Kambosos he makes a stronger case. Usyk only has titles in 2 divisions but campaigning at heavy means he's fighting much bigger men and that jump up from cruiser the heavyweight is a far harder jump up because of that. If he does beat Fury and becomes undisputed and wins the rematch then he has a very strong case, especially if he retires undefeated. But we don't know what else Loma and Canelo will do. What if Canelo does win a title at cruiserweight? What if Loma after beating Lopez and Kambosos jumps up in weight again and wins another title at a new weight. What if Crawford unifies welterweight beating Spence while doing it and maybe he too moves up in weight again, we all know he cuts a lot of weight. So right now there's no way to know who really will be the best of their era, but Usyk is in the mix for sure and he's my number 1 right now.
